Jasmine rice

Step 1

Cook the rice according to the package instructions. Set it aside to cool. (Refrigerating it overnight is even better!)

Yellow onion

Step 2

Peel & mince the onion.

Yellow onion
Snow peas (fresh)
Cooked shrimp
Peas (frozen)

Step 3

Heat a drizzle of vegetable oil in a pan over medium heat. Add the onions, peas, snow peas & thawed cooked shrimp. Stir fry for 2 min.

Jasmine rice
Soy sauce

Step 4

Add the chilled rice & soy sauce.

Step 5

Stir fry for 3 min, until the ingredients are heated through & the flavors combined.

Cilantro (fresh)

Step 6

Garnish with fresh cilantro leaves (optional). Enjoy!
